In Episode 3 of Tech in the Cities: When Every Company Is a Tech Company, Tom Allon, Founder and Publisher of City & State, and Julie Samuels, Founder, President, and CEO of Tech:NYC, explore how New York can prepare its workforce for the AI economy.
Joined by Ben Zweig, Founder and CEO of Revelio Labs and professor of Data Bootcamp and The Future of Work at NYU Stern, alongside Lauren Andersen, Vice Chancellor for Career Engagement and Industry Partnerships at CUNY, Tom and Julie discuss how AI is changing hiring, why New York is uniquely positioned to lead, and how stronger partnerships between employers and higher education can prepare the next generation of talent.
